## Onboarding: Validex Plugin System

Welcome to the security review of Validex, our plugin framework for data validators. Plugins are sandboxed and signed before loading; the manifest registry enforces version pinning, and unsigned plugins are rejected at load time. Reviewers receive read-only access by default. Should the signing service become unavailable during your review window, an offline verification bundle can be unlocked for audit purposes. The recovery passphrase that opens that bundle is provided directly below.

unlock words, kagef-taduf: fenir-quenix-norwyn-sorvan-gormir-gorir-fraok

# Settings: event schema registry
#
# Reviewer notes: the Pellgrove registry validates every event
# payload against a versioned schema before it reaches the bus.
# Unknown schema versions are rejected, not coerced — this is
# intentional; see RFC-22. Compatibility mode is BACKWARD only.
# Cache TTL is 60s; do not raise it without benchmarking the
# validator path first. Registry metadata (schemas, versions,
# compat rules) lives in its own database, separate from the
# event store. The registry connects using the string below.

primary connection of badup-fahop = postgresql://praael_svc:IJ@db-b405.halixstack.internal:5432/tamael

Handover — Grainhawk telemetry gateway

You're taking over the gateway that ingests tractor and harvester telemetry from the Dellmark pilot farms. Core loop: MQTT in, batch, push to the warehouse every five minutes. Known issues: firmware v3 units occasionally double-report fuel sensors; dedupe handles it. Don't touch the retry queue during harvest season — backlog is normal. Restart procedure is in the wiki; it's safe and idempotent. Before you do anything, set up your local env with the values below.

config for kafof-bawef:
holath:
  log_level: debug
  metrics_host: metrics.holath.qorvelsys.internal
  pin: 2191
  pool_size: 32